Australia bans government use of Kaspersky software due to ‘unacceptable security risk’

by Priya Kapoor
2 minutes read

In recent news, the Australian government has made a significant decision to ban the use of Kaspersky software due to what they have deemed an “unacceptable security risk.” This move follows similar actions taken by the United States, Canada, and the United Kingdom, highlighting growing concerns over the use of technology from the Russian cybersecurity giant.
